The goddess of love pays a visit to Brunhild, calling herself Touya's older sister, Mochizuki Karen. Apparently she came there to refresh (enjoy a vacation) because Touya is so surrounded by love.
Released: Jan 01, 1970
Runtime: 00:24:14 minutes
Genre: Animation, Action & Adventure, Comedy, Sci-Fi & Fantasy